hbomberguy showed a lot of specific examples of blatant plagiarism from 4 or 5 very large youtube channels. They were basically just Googling topics every day, changing scripts/articles from “but” to “and” or “he went” to “he traveled” and then reading it off to B-roll they often also stole. Many of them were also just stealing entirely from one production, as in just recreating a documentary in its entirety. They were making hundreds of thousands to millions of dollars by stealing all this stuff. At that point it’s less of “some rando” and more like a substantial media operation ripping people off

The plagiarist stealing queer content was always getting compliments for great writing, and it turns out when they did a second pass on a script they got caught on, trying to change the words around a just a bit more, he was actually a dogshit writer
